将流量从 VPN 重新路由并转发到 WiFi

将流量从 VPN 重新路由并转发到 WiFi

我是 Linux 新手。我已经设置了一个OpenVPN服务器在我的一台运行 Raspbian 系统的 Raspberry Pi 4 上(皮VPN脚本)。然后我在我的另一台Raspberry Pi 4上设置客户端OpenVPN(第一台服务器在我父母在国外的家里)。我可以轻松连接它们、我的笔记本电脑或 Android 智能手机,一切正常。

最近我将客户端设置为无线上网热点,这样我就可以连接许多设备并从 Raspberry 服务器获取 IP(绕过地理限制)。一旦我启动 VPN 连接,我就会失去 WiFi 上的互联网连接(客户端 Raspberry Pi)。昨天,我得到了 USB-RJ45 以太网适配器,但通过此适配器,我遇到了同样的问题。

我想我需要更改配置中的路由和转发。
有人可以帮我吗?

答案1

sudo iptables -F
sudo iptables -t nat -F
sudo iptables -X
sudo iptables -t nat -A POSTROUTING -o tun0 -j MASQUERADE
sudo sh -c "iptables-save > /etc/iptables.ipv4.nat"

相关内容